block |
a solid piece of hard material with flat sides. |
choir |
a group of people who sing together, especially a group that sings religious music; chorus. |
colorful |
having many colors; bright in color. |
complete |
having all of the parts that are necessary; whole. |
counter |
a long, high table. People sit on stools or stand at a counter to eat, prepare food, or do business. |
dive |
to move down from a high place at high speed, with the head or front part first. |
drown |
to die under water because of lack of air. |
elect |
to choose by means of voting. |
flake |
a small, thin piece that has split off from or peeled off of a surface. |
male |
having to do with a person or animal of the sex that does not produce eggs or give birth. |
pilot |
a person who flies an airplane or other aircraft. |
sick |
having an illness; not well. |
skate |
to move over ice or another hard surface using shoes that have a blade or wheels attached to the bottom. |
straw |
dried stems of certain grain plants. Straw is used to feed farm animals and to make things such as baskets and hats. |
suck |
to pull into the mouth by using the tongue and lips. |
